5V, 1A- 5A Programmable Current Limit Switch

The MP5001 is a protection device designed to protect circuitry on the output source from transients on input VCC . It also protects VCC from undesired shorts and transients coming from the source.

At start up, inrush current is limited by limiting the slew rate at the source. The slew rate is controlled by a small capacitor at the dv/dt pin. The dv/dt pin has an internal circuit that allows the customer to float this pin no connect and still receive a 1.1ms ramp time at the source.

The max load at the output source is current limited. This is accomplished by utilizing a sense FET topology. The magnitude of the current limit is controlled by an external resistor from the ILimit pin to the Source pin.

The source is protected from the VCC input being too low or too high. Under Voltage Lockout UVLO assures that VCC is above the minimum operating threshold, before the power device is turned on. If VCC goes above the high output threshold, the source voltage will be limited.
